Our ERS Dispatchers are there to help our policyholders when they experience problems with their vehicles. As an ERS Dispatcher, you'll be trained to assist customers in obtaining help when there is a problem with their vehicle, such as locating and dispatching a locksmith or a tow truck. You will learn about our dynamic industry and prepare to assist customers through our comprehensive, fully paid training program.
As an Emergency Roadside Service Dispatcher, you will:
- Receive incoming calls from existing policyholders
- Gather pertinent information to assist the customer
- Dispatch help to the customer's location
- Negotiate estimated time of arrival to customers with tow truck operators and locksmiths
- Maintain customer satisfaction by providing friendly and professional service
Job Requirements
- High school diploma or equivalent
- Prior customer service experience
- Demonstrated job stability
- Effective verbal and written communication skills
- Excellent computer and multi-tasking skills
- High level of dependability
- Must be comfortable working in a call center environment
